I am embarking on my first Camino between mid October and mid November and am considering the Camino del Norte (starting in San Sebastian). Can anyone comment on the availability of services such lodging, cafes, and bars this time of year and how well the route is marked and traveled by other pilgrims. Thank you.

Hi, I walked the Norte from mid-Oct to mid-Nov 2016, and it was perfect – weather, pilgrim places to stay (no bed rush), and just the right number of others to meet and chat to along the way. The route is very well marked. I highly recommend that time of year.
